Spatial and temporal patterns in population change for Barn Swallow, from the North American Breeding Bird Survey #NABBS.
Increasing across most of its range until the early 1980s. Since then decreasing and most strongly in the north.
This change-point in the 1980s is common for most species of swallows, swifts, and nightjars in North America.
